@import"https://fonts.googleapis.com/css2?family=Inter:ital,opsz,wght@0,14..32,100..900;1,14..32,100..900&family=Manrope:wght@200..800&family=Montserrat:ital,wght@0,100..900;1,100..900&display=swap";body{background:#252525;color:#fff;font-family:Montserrat,serif}:where(*,*:before,*:after){box-sizing:border-box}:where(*){margin:0;padding:0}:where(html,body){height:100%}:where(html:focus-within){scroll-behavior:smooth}:where(body){line-height:1.5;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}:where(img,picture,video,canvas,svg){display:block;max-width:100%}:where(input,button,textarea,select){font:inherit;color:inherit}:where(button){background:none;border:0;cursor:pointer}:where(textarea){white-space:revert}:where(a){color:inherit;text-decoration:none}:where(p,h1,h2,h3,h4,h5,h6){overflow-wrap:break-word}:where(ul,ol){list-style:none}:where(table){border-collapse:collapse;border-spacing:0}:where(blockquote,q){quotes:none}:where(blockquote:before,blockquote:after,q:before,q:after){content:""}:where(fieldset,legend){border:0;padding:0}:where([hidden]){display:none!important}:where(:focus-visible){outline:2px solid currentColor;outline-offset:2px}@media (prefers-reduced-motion: reduce){:where(html:focus-within){scroll-behavior:auto}:where(*,*:before,*:after){anim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}
